What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a pickleball coach,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Pickleball Coach, you need a solid understanding of game rules, strategies, and techniques, often demonstrated by prior competitive experience or coaching certifications. Familiarity with training tools, video analysis software, and safety equipment is typically required. Strong communication, motivational skills, and patience help coaches effectively teach and inspire players of all levels. These abilities are crucial for fostering skill development, maximizing player potential, and ensuring a positive and safe learning environment.

What are common challenges faced by professional pickleball players in maintaining peak performance throughout a tournament season?

Professional pickleball players often encounter challenges such as managing physical fatigue, preventing injuries, and adapting to different playing surfaces or climates during a busy tournament season. Balancing intensive training with adequate rest and recovery is crucial to maintain performance and avoid burnout. Additionally, players must stay up-to-date with evolving strategies and collaborate with coaches or doubles partners to refine their gameplay. Building mental resilience and maintaining consistent focus are also key factors for long-term success in the sport.

We are looking for an experienced Director of Racquet Sports to oversee all aspects of our racquet sports operations. This position will be responsible for creating exceptional member experiences, delivering a premier racquet sports event program and leading a team of high-level racquet sports staff.

Responsibilities:
  • Serves as a visible, accessible leader of the racquet sports operation, fostering a positive, cohesive, and high-performing team environment.
  • Selects, trains, retains and develops a high-level tennis and pickleball staff.
  • Schedules tennis and pickleball staff to meet membership needs and demands. Ensures the Racquet Sports desk is staffed to provide excellent service to members and their guests.
  • Schedules clinics to maximize participation and service to the greatest number of members.
  • Oversees scheduling of court time to provide appropriate balance of clinics, open courts and private instruction to maximize participation and enjoyment of all members.
  • Works with the Controller and General Manager/COO in preparation of the annual racquet sports department budget.
  • Implements and manages the annual racquet sports budget within approved guidelines.
  • Prepares recommended lesson and clinic fee structure for review and approval by the General Manager/COO.
  • Closely monitors the collection of fees such as clinic fees, lesson fees, court fees, guest fees, and team fees.
  • Develops and delivers a premier tennis and pickleball event program, including championships, member-guest tournaments, and social events for juniors and adults.
  • Serves as the emcee of the member tennis and pickleball events.
  • Writes a monthly racquet sports article for the Club newsletter.
  • Develops a monthly and annual calendar of activities, programs, and events for members.
  • Periodically reviews and benchmarks programs against those at other Clubs both locally and nationally, to maintain the highest continuing level of quality for Club members.
  • Operates outstanding instructional programs for women, men, and junior players.
  • Develops and offers programs during weekday evenings, after school, on weekends, and during daytime hours.
  • Develops and offers programs during the summer school vacation and during other school vacation weeks.
  • Directs and coordinates the formation of all Club racquet sports events. Serves as the creative leader of the department to offer exciting year-round programs and offerings.
  • Ensures the preparation of the facility and courts for all league matches and practices.
  • Coordinates team clinics and team practice sessions with team captains.
  • Supervises and directs all tennis/pickleball staff in planning and coordinating all instructional programs, lesson plans and new programs.
  • Teaches lessons, clinics and team practice sessions for members, spouses and their children.
  • Oversees the implementation of a broad Junior Development Program that is responsive to changing member expectations.
  • Ensures accurate completion of member charges and payment for all “program lessons” - (i.e., Team Coaching and special instructional programs).
  • Coordinates and implements the submission of all league information.
  • Publishes all roster deadline and start dates for all league play, on the Club web site and in the Club newsletter.
  • Ensures the accurate billing of all member charges, guest fees, and other associated fees.
  • Plans and coordinates the scheduling of courts for all member play, league practices, clinics and matches.
  • Ensures that Club rules are observed by all users of the tennis/pickleball facilities and equipment.
  • Reports all non-compliance to the Beachside Committee and General Manager/COO.
  • Enforces the Club's Guest and Non-Member Usage Policy.
  • Promotes all aspects of the program to the membership accurately and in a timely fashion.
  • Issues regular updates concerning the tennis program to the General Manager/COO.
  • Provides timely and relevant information and updates for the tennis/pickleball portion of the Club’s website.
  • Oversees the courts to ensure a first-class playing experience for members and their guests.
  • Ensures that all areas of the tennis facilities are always neat, clean, and in good repair.
  • Works to ensure that all necessary personnel for the maintenance and upkeep of the courts are hired and trained.
  • Ensures that the necessary equipment for the maintenance and upkeep of the facilities is on hand and properly maintained.
  • Inspects, on a periodic basis, the quality of the playing surfaces, fences, windscreens, water coolers, teaching equipment and courtside amenities; and makes recommendations for improvements.
  • Ensures racquet sports programs are planned, implemented, and managed in a safe manner, in accordance with Club policies, procedures, and established safety standards.
  • Keeps the General Manager/COO informed on the status of the facilities and equipment for the purpose of budgeting for replacement and repair.
  • Meets with other Department Heads weekly or as requested.
  • Treats all members fairly, honestly, uniformly and with respect.
  • Complies with all Club employee regulations and policies.
  • Promotes the Club in a manner consistent with its world-class image to members and non-members, whenever possible.
  • Coordinates racquet stringing service for members.
  • Takes advantage of Continuing Education opportunities to maintain professional certifications, and to stay abreast of state-of-the-art teaching techniques and methodology.
  • Other duties as assigned by the General Manager/COO.

Qualifications:
  • Bachelor’s Degree (B.A.) and 7 years of related experience or equivalent combination of education/experience.
  • Progressive racquet operations leadership or management experience. Experience at an active, upscale private country club or resort is preferred.
  • Demonstrated leadership in operational change management, with the ability to successfully implement new initiatives, improve processes, adapt to changing member needs and foster employee engagement.
  • Demonstrates exceptional ver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to communicate clearly, professionally, and effectively with members, guests, employees, and Club leadership.
  • Proficient at utilizing Windows software. General working knowledge of Point-of-Sale systems and electronic court registration software is preferred.
  • Strong racquet playing background, NTRP level 4.0 or higher.
  • Must be a certified Tennis professional (RSPA Elite or Master Professional) and/or a certified Pickleball Professional (RSPA and/or PPR).
  • Must be able to work a flexible schedule including nights, weekends and holidays.
